Once a quiet satellite city near Mumbai, Thane has undergone significant changes over the years, especially in the last decade. The growth has come about due to the development plans undertaken including the development of real estate.
With Thane`s growth came a boom in the populace which, until the balance is struck, could cause further duress to the infrastructure. The second-largest city of Maharashtra and Chief Minister Eknath Shinde`s bastion faces its share of civic issues like infrastructure gaps, encroachments of roads, traffic congestion and lack of parking spaces.
